A Letter From Our Pastor: Our Annual Stewardship Financial Report

I am pleased to present to you the Annual Stewardship Financial Report. This last fiscal year, the COVID-19 pandemic presented many challenges to our church and families. However, we know the one constant in our lives is God. He continues to provide for our needs, and we look to Him for the gifts He freely gives with His grace and guidance. I invite you to review our financial statements on the following pages with a spirit of gratitude and thankfulness as we are blessed by God’s gifts.

Our Sunday offerings provide for 90 percent of our total parish income. These funds are used to support the parish administrative and operating activities, in addition to the support of our many ministries. With a budget shortfall of $103,081 in offertory collections, how did we continue to provide for these needs? We did so in part with your continued support and generosity.

Many of our faith families who were unable to attend Mass found ways to continue their financial support. We saw an increase in online giving and many families chose to mail in their contributions. This allowed us to honor our commitment to:

— Tithe 10 percent of Sunday Collections to ministries and organizations

— Support Catholic education

— Provide for maintenance needs

— Retain all staffing positions

Credit must also be given to the parish staff. Through their efforts, operating expenses were cut by 15 percent — $323,785.

Your generosity combined with the support of our staff, ministry leaders, and the delay of special property and facility projects enabled us to end the fiscal year with a net operating surplus of $314,771.

In addition, we were able to fund emergency needs through a generous bequest that allowed us to install an air purification system in the church providing for a safer, cleaner environment.

On behalf of the Pastoral and Finance Councils, I want to thank you for your continued support of our parish mission with the gift of your time, talent and treasure. Your generosity is a witness to God’s love and His infinite gifts.
